Porto midfielder Sérgio Oliveira is interesting Tottenham.
O Jogo says Tottenham are in contact with Porto for Oliveira and willing to offer €20m to sign him.
Spurs are in talks with Porto, despite not having a manager in place.
Juventus and Jose Mourinho’s Roma are also keen. Oliveira renewed his contract with Porto at the end of last year.
But at 29, the Portugal international knows this could be his last chance to play in a bigger competition.
